Pivots / Linears
A pivot irrigator is made from spans consisting of steel water pipes held up by a steel supporting structure. Each span is mounted on a drive tower and base beam incorporating an electric gear motor driving a set of gearboxes and tractor wheels. Pivots move around a centre point, operate in either direction and can complete either a part-circle or full-circle operation. A linear irrigator consists of the same spans and drive tower mechanism as a pivot. The machines differ as both ends of the linear move when walking, allowing the machine to move in a linear motion and irrigate rectangle land areas.
